Astronics awarded $7.4 million contracts from Asian commercial airlines

Astronics Corporation a has signed contracts with two Asian commercial airlines totaling approximately $7.4 million for its EMPOWER In-Seat Power Supply System (ISPS). Willis Lease Finance earns $4.2 million in second quarter

Willis Lease Finance Corporation reported solid second quarter and year-to-date profitability fueled by growth in its lease portfolio as well as lower borrowing costs. Jet Aviation Dubai expands service offerings

Jet Aviation Dubai has recently expanded its service offerings to include base and line maintenance for Hawker 750/800/800XP/850XP/900XP, Gulfstream G350/G450 and Embraer 135/145 aircraft under the company’s EASA #145.0317 approval. Bombardier terminates purchase agreement with MyAir.com of Italy

Bombardier Aerospace has terminated its firm order purchase agreement with MyAir.com of Italy in respect of all remaining undelivered aircraft.
